Greetings, AFSCME family,

We were honored to represent you as Local 2620’s elected delegates at the recent AFSCME International Convention.

Throughout the week, we participated in the business of our International Union, including the election of AFSCME’s International President and Secretary-Treasurer, consideration of more than 80 resolutions, several constitutional amendments, and review of more than 20 Judicial Panel appeals.

We also attended committee meetings, workshops, and educational sessions on topics such as stewardship, organizing, finances, leadership, advocacy, and member representation. By attending different sessions, we brought back a broader range of ideas and information that can benefit our Local.



Our delegation included both first-time and returning delegates. For all of us, the convention was an important reminder that Local 2620 is part of a much larger union. While we may represent a small portion of AFSCME’s overall membership, our participation gives Local 2620 a voice.

We were especially proud to see fellow delegate Sonia Ruiz address the full convention from the floor, ensuring that Local 2620 was heard before delegates from across the country.

The convention was also an opportunity to meet members from other locals and councils, exchange ideas, learn from their experiences, and build relationships that can strengthen our work here in California.



As delegates, we understand that our responsibility does not end when the convention is over. We were elected to represent you, and we believe the knowledge, experiences, and connections we gained should come back to the membership.
